Skip to content

Commit

Permalink
test: fix
Browse files Browse the repository at this point in the history
  • Loading branch information
ota-meshi committed May 9, 2023
1 parent fc8afd2 commit faf168d
Show file tree
Hide file tree
Showing 2 changed files with 6 additions and 20 deletions.
6 changes: 4 additions & 2 deletions tests/src/meta.ts
Original file line number Diff line number Diff line change
Expand Up @@ -8,12 +8,14 @@ const expectedMeta = {

describe("Test for meta object", () => {
it("A plugin should have a meta object.", () => {
assert.deepStrictEqual(plugin.meta, expectedMeta)
assert.strictEqual(plugin.meta.name, expectedMeta.name)
assert.strictEqual(typeof plugin.meta.version, "string")
})

for (const [name, processor] of Object.entries(plugin.processors)) {
it(`"${name}" processor should have a meta object.`, () => {
assert.deepStrictEqual(processor.meta, expectedMeta)
assert.strictEqual(processor.meta.name, expectedMeta.name)
assert.strictEqual(typeof processor.meta.version, "string")
})
}
})
20 changes: 2 additions & 18 deletions tools/lib/changesets-util.ts
Original file line number Diff line number Diff line change
@@ -1,25 +1,9 @@
import assembleReleasePlan from "@changesets/assemble-release-plan"
import readChangesets from "@changesets/read"
import { read } from "@changesets/config"
import { getPackages } from "@manypkg/get-packages"
import { readPreState } from "@changesets/pre"
import getReleasePlan from "@changesets/get-release-plan"
import path from "path"

const root = path.resolve(__dirname, "../..")

/** Get new version string from changesets */
export async function getNewVersion(): Promise<string> {
const packages = await getPackages(root)
const preState = await readPreState(root)
const config = await read(root, packages)
const changesets = await readChangesets(root)

const releasePlan = assembleReleasePlan(
changesets,
packages,
config,
preState,
)
const releasePlan = await getReleasePlan(path.resolve(__dirname, "../.."))

return releasePlan.releases.find(
({ name }) => name === "eslint-plugin-svelte",
Expand Down

0 comments on commit faf168d

Please sign in to comment.